These are the activities I didn’t get pictures of:
- Counted goldfish crackers on a piece of construction paper cut out in the shape of a fishbowl.
- Colored a crab and octopus shaped mask (found at Joann’s for $1)
- Fed the fish at Grandma and Grandpa’s house (Madi’s favorite)
